A hiker caught in a rainstorm absorbs 1.00 L of water in her clothing. If it is windy so that the water evaporates quickly at 20 ° C, how much heat is required for this process? Express your answer using three significant figures and include the appropriate units H = 2440 kJ Submit My Answers Give Up Correct Significant Figures Feedback: Your answer 2.45.106 J(-2450 kJ was either rounded differently or used a different number of significant figures than required for this part. rt B If all this heat is removed from the hiker (no significant heat was generated by metabolism during this time), what drop in body temperature would the hiker experience? The clothed hiker weighs 75 kg, and you can approximate the heat capacity of hiker and clothes as equal to that of water. (Moral: stay out of the wind if you get your clothes wet.) Express your answer using two significant figures and include the appropriate units. Submit My Answers Give Up Incorrect; Try Again; 5 attempts remaining rt C How many grams of sucrose would the hiker have to metabolize (quickly) to replace the heat of evaporating 1.00 L of water so that her temperature would not change? You can use the enthalpy of reaction at 25 C;the sucrose (s) reacts with oxygen (g) to give carbon dioxide (g) and water (1) Express your answer using three significant figures and include the appropriate units

Explanation / Answer

Part B:

Total heat=2440 KJ

Specific heat of evaporation for water = 4.187 KJ/KgK

Heat = Specific heat x mass x change in temperature

2440=4.187 x 75 x dT

dT = 7.77 K

Part C:

Total heat of evaporation = m x Latent heat = 1Kg x 2,260 kJ/kg= 2260 KJ

Enthalphy of sucrose reaction = -5645 kJ/mol

So, 1 mole = 342.3 grams

Enthalphy of sucrose reaction= - 16.49 kJ/gm

So, total mass of sucrose needed = 2260/16.49 gm = 137.04 gm
